Output 89f99dbba8aeb400ab0e5343a5c000c492274067f6f90ecf888bc4b5d3dab57a:0

value
250000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b66093f33024503064844ec4f8a25b4e0580c940 OP_EQUAL
address
3JKLbosyRjKnMgydEBYZMwm4u2fM2TARu2
transaction
89f99dbba8aeb400ab0e5343a5c000c492274067f6f90ecf888bc4b5d3dab57a
confirmations
256289
spent
true